LV x TM LV Trainer Sneaker Black

R50,000.00

 

The iconic LV Trainer sneaker makes a fresh statement in grained calf leather featuring an allover print of a multicolored Monogram motif from the re-edition of Louis Vuitton x Murakami collection, inspired by the artist’s exuberant aesthetic. Informed by vintage sporty styles, the upper is detailed with a cursive Louis Vuitton signature, while the back is printed with the number 54 in reference to 1854, the year the House was founded.

  • Multicolored
  • Grained calf leather
  • Laces
  • Signature prints
  • Rubber outsole with Monogram Flowers
  • Made in Italy
Product Care
To preserve the beauty of your product, we recommend following these guidelines for its care:

Clean grained leather with a soft damp cloth. when the leather is dry, apply a quality colorless cream and polish in circular motions with a soft cloth.

It is important to allow your sneakers to air naturally, and to this end they possess a removable insole. If your sneakers become wet, simply remove the insole and leave them to dry in a cool, well-ventilated place. This will ensure additional comfort when they are next worn.
Avoid contact with water, any substance containing alcohol (perfumes, solvents etc) or oil (makeup) and abrasive products in general. If the shoes have been in contact with water, it is important to allow them to dry thoroughly on shoe trees before cleaning them.
Always use a shoehorn when putting shoes on.
Keep your shoes in the two felt pouches provided and store them in a cool, dry and well-ventilated place.
